Skip to main content
Element Software
Une version plus récente de ce produit est disponible.
La version française est une traduction automatique. La version anglaise prévaut sur la française en cas de divergence.

CreateSupportBundle

Contributeurs

Vous pouvez utiliser CreateSupportBundle pour créer un fichier de bundle de support sous le répertoire du nœud. Après la création, le bundle est stocké sur le nœud en tant que fichier tar (l'option de compression gz est disponible via le paramètre extraArgs).

Paramètres

Cette méthode présente les paramètres d'entrée suivants :

Nom Description Type Valeur par défaut Obligatoire

Nom du gigollName

Nom unique pour le bundle de support. Si aucun nom n'est fourni, « supportbundle » et le nom du nœud sont utilisés comme nom de fichier.

chaîne

Aucune

Non

Extraargs

Utilisez '--compress gz' pour créer le bundle de support en tant que fichier tar.gz.

chaîne

Aucune

Non

Timeoutsec

Nombre de secondes pendant lesquelles le script de bundle de support s'exécute.

entier

1500

Non

Valeurs de retour

Cette méthode a les valeurs de retour suivantes :

Nom

Description

Type

détails

Détails du pack de support. Valeurs possibles :

  • BundleName : nom spécifié dans la méthode CreateSupportBundleAPI. Si aucun nom n'a été spécifié, « supportbundle » est utilisé.

  • ExtraArgs : les arguments ont réussi avec cette méthode.

  • Fichiers : liste des fichiers de bundle de support créés par le système.

  • Résultat : sortie de la ligne de commande à partir du script qui a créé le bundle de support.

  • Timeoutsec : nombre de secondes pendant lesquelles le script de bundle de support s'exécute avant l'arrêt.

  • url : URL vers le bundle de support créé.

Objet JSON

durée

Temps utilisé pour créer le pack de support au format suivant : HH:MM:SS.ssss.

chaîne

résultat

Le succès ou l'échec de l'opération de bundle de support.

chaîne

Exemple de demande

Les demandes pour cette méthode sont similaires à l'exemple suivant :

{
 "method": "CreateSupportBundle",
"params": {
  "extraArgs": "--compress gz"
 },
"id": 1
}

Exemple de réponse

Cette méthode renvoie une réponse similaire à l'exemple suivant :

{
"id": 1,
"result": {
  "details": {
    "bundleName": "supportbundle",
    "extraArgs": "--compress gz",
    "files": [
         "supportbundle.nodehostname.tar.gz"
     ],
     "output": "timeout -s KILL 1500s /sf/scripts/sfsupportbundle --quiet --compress gz /tmp/solidfire-dtemp.1L6bdX/supportbundle<br><br>Moved '/tmp/solidfire-dtemp.1L6bdX/supportbundle.nodehostname.tar.gz' to /tmp/supportbundles",
      "timeoutSec": 1500,
      "url": [
          "https://nodeIP:442/config/supportbundles/supportbundle.nodehostname.tar.gz"
      ]
    },
    "duration": "00:00:43.101627",
    "result": "Passed"
  }
}

Nouveau depuis la version

9.6